About Autonomous Robots


Autonomous Robots is a journal published by Springer Netherlands. This journal covers the area[s] related to Artificial Intelligence, etc. The coverage history of this journal is as follows: 1994-2022. The rank of this journal is 3247. This journal's impact score, h-index, and SJR are 3.64, 123, and 1.165, respectively. The ISSN of this journal is/are as follows: 15737527, 09295593.

The best quartile of Autonomous Robots is Q1. This journal has received a total of 1138 citations during the last three years (Preceding 2022).

What is h-index?

The h-index (also known as the Hirsch index or Hirsh index) is a scientometric parameter used to evaluate the scientific impact of the publications and journals. It is defined as the maximum value of h such that the given Journal has published at least h papers and each has at least h citations.




Autonomous Robots ISSN


The International Standard Serial Number (ISSN) of Autonomous Robots is/are as follows: 15737527, 09295593.

The ISSN is a unique 8-digit identifier for a specific publication like Magazine or Journal. The ISSN is used in the postal system and in the publishing world to identify the articles that are published in journals, magazines, newsletters, etc. This is the number assigned to your article by the publisher, and it is the one you will use to reference your article within the library catalogues.

ISSN code (also called as "ISSN structure" or "ISSN syntax") can be expressed as follows: NNNN-NNNC
Here, N is in the set {0,1,2,3...,9}, a digit character, and C is in {0,1,2,3,...,9,X}

Abbreviation


The International Organization for Standardization 4 (ISO 4) abbreviation of Autonomous Robots is Auton. Robots. ISO 4 is an international standard which defines a uniform and consistent system for the abbreviation of serial publication titles, which are published regularly. The primary use of ISO 4 is to abbreviate or shorten the names of scientific journals using the technique of List of Title Word Abbreviations (LTWA).

As ISO 4 is an international standard, the abbreviation ('Auton. Robots') can be used for citing, indexing, abstraction, and referencing purposes.
